Thomas is the namesake and patron saint of Villanova University, near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He was a noted preacher, ascetic and religious writer of his day and became an archbishop who was famous for his care for the poor.

The University of Villanova is named after Saint Thomas of Villanova, a 16th-century Spanish Augustinian friar known for his charitable works and dedication to education. He served as the Archbishop of Valencia and was recognized for his efforts to aid the poor and promote social justice. The university, founded in 1842, reflects his commitment to academic excellence and service.
